通過上一篇關於並行計算准備部分的介紹,我們知道MPI(Message-Passing-Interface 消息傳遞接口)實現並行是進程級別的,通過通信在進程之間進行消息傳遞。MPI並不是一種新的開發語言,它是一個定義了可以被C、C++和Fortran程序調用的函數庫。這些函數庫里面主要涉及 ...
caffe版本:https: github.com yjxiong caffe 使用環境: View Code CUDA . CuDNN . OpenCV . . 以及其他caffe所需要的依賴已經裝好,這里僅需要安裝OpenMPI . . ,步驟如下: OpenMPI . . 安裝 . 解壓openmpi . . ,進入解壓后的文件夾 openmpi . . ,在終端輸入如下命令: View C ...
2019-01-16 18:35 0 722 推薦指數:
通過上一篇關於並行計算准備部分的介紹,我們知道MPI(Message-Passing-Interface 消息傳遞接口)實現並行是進程級別的,通過通信在進程之間進行消息傳遞。MPI並不是一種新的開發語言,它是一個定義了可以被C、C++和Fortran程序調用的函數庫。這些函數庫里面主要涉及 ...
通過上一篇中,知道了基本的MPI編寫並行程序,最后的例子中,讓使用0號進程做全局的求和的所有工作,而其他的進程卻都不工作,這種方式也許是某種特定情況下的方案,但明顯不是最好的方案。舉個例子,如果我們讓偶數號的進程負責收集求和的工作,情況會怎么樣?如下圖: 對比之前 ...
Python 並行分布式框架 Celery Celery 官網:http://www.celeryproject.orgCelery 官方文檔英文版:http ...
這個作業的要求來自於:https://edu.cnblogs.com/campus/gzcc/GZCC-16SE2/homework/3319。 1.用自己的話闡明Hadoop平台上HDFS和MapReduce的功能、工作原理和工作過程。 HDFS 功能:分布式文件系統,用來存儲海量 ...
Jenkins分布式構建與並行構建 jenkins的架構 Jenkins采用的是“master+agent(slave)”架構。Jenkins master負責提供界面、處理HTTP請求及管理構建環境;構建的執行則由Jenkins agent負責 Jenkins agent的橫向擴容:只需要 ...
電腦上目前使用的mpi環境是2.1.1版本的openmpi,是我之前直接使用系統的包管理工具安裝的。但是系統包版本一般都比較老舊,現在openmpi最新版已經出到了4.0,即將出4.1了,所以我打算升級一下系統里的mpi環境。 本地環境: Corei7 9700k ...
如題: 最近在看MPI方面的東西,主要是Python下的MPI4PY,學校有超算機房可以使用MPI,但是需要申請什么的比較麻煩,目的也本就是為了學習一下,所以就想着在自己的電腦上先配置一下。 現有硬件:兩台裝有Ubuntu18.04的操作系統(下面簡稱A電腦,B電腦) A電腦: 24物理核心 ...
[源碼解析] PyTorch 分布式(18) --- 使用 RPC 的分布式管道並行 目錄 [源碼解析] PyTorch 分布式(18) --- 使用 RPC 的分布式管道並行 0x00 摘要 0x01 綜述 1.1 ...